Stratigraphy
Geological group: | Wilcox | Formation: | Tuscahoma | Member: | Greggs Landing Marl |
Stratigraphic resolution: | group of beds | ||||
Stratigraphy comments: The Greggs Landing Marl Member, about 6 feet thick, exposed near the bottom of a high bluff, yields numerous well preserved mollusks and a colonial coral. The Bells Landing Marl Member is exposed near the top of the steep bluff 27 feet higher than the top of the Greggs Landing Marl Member and contains the characteristic large spheroidal concretions and large Ostrea sinuosa, Venericardia aposmithii and Turritella postmortoni and a few other characteristic fossils which fall down the bluff and are mixed with the Greggs Landing fossils. |
Lithology and environment
Primary lithology: | fine,medium,glauconitic,gray,green unlithified silty,calcareous sandstone |
Secondary lithology: | glauconitic unlithified sandy sandstone |
Lithology description: Greggs Landing Marl Member is sand, grayish-green, weathers to brown, massive, fine- to medium grained, silty, calcareous, glauconitic, very fossiliferous. The lower bed contains small particles of lignite and spheroidal calcareous sandstone concretions. | |
Environment: | shallow subtidal indet. |
